"""
This scripts tests creating an Android Studio project using the
generate_gradle.py script and making a debug build using it.
It expect to be given the webrtc output build directory as the first argument
all other arguments are optional.
"""
import argparse
import logging
import os
import shutil
import subprocess
import sys
import tempfile
SCRIPT_DIR = os.path.dirname(os.path.abspath(__file__))
SRC_DIR = os.path.normpath(os.path.join(SCRIPT_DIR, os.pardir, os.pardir))
GENERATE_GRADLE_SCRIPT = os.path.join(SRC_DIR,
'build/android/gradle/generate_gradle.py')
GRADLEW_BIN = os.path.join(SCRIPT_DIR, 'third_party/gradle/gradlew')
def _RunCommand(argv, cwd=SRC_DIR, **kwargs):
logging.info('Running %r', argv)
subprocess.check_call(argv, cwd=cwd, **kwargs)
def _ParseArgs():
parser = argparse.ArgumentParser(
description='Test generating Android gradle project.')
parser.add_argument('build_dir_android',
help='The path to the build directory for Android.')
parser.add_argument('--project_dir',
help='A temporary directory to put the output.')
args = parser.parse_args()
return args
def main():
logging.basicConfig(level=logging.INFO)
args = _ParseArgs()
project_dir = args.project_dir
if not project_dir:
project_dir = tempfile.mkdtemp()
output_dir = os.path.abspath(args.build_dir_android)
project_dir = os.path.abspath(project_dir)
try:
env = os.environ.copy()
env['PATH'] = os.pathsep.join([
os.path.join(SRC_DIR, 'third_party', 'depot_tools'), env.get('PATH', '')
])
_RunCommand([GENERATE_GRADLE_SCRIPT, '--output-directory', output_dir,
'--target', '//examples:AppRTCMobile',
'--project-dir', project_dir,
'--use-gradle-process-resources', '--split-projects', '--canary'],
env=env)
_RunCommand([GRADLEW_BIN, 'assembleDebug'], project_dir)
finally:
# Do not delete temporary directory if user specified it manually.
if not args.project_dir:
shutil.rmtree(project_dir, True)
if __name__ == '__main__':
sys.exit(main())
